This alarm is present when the total shutdown command has been activated using either the control panel or
the RS232 connection.
The system carries out the command after a delay of several seconds, giving the user time to cancel the
command, if required.
The command is memorised even when the system is shutdown due to insufficient power supply.
[20] REMOTE SYSTEM OFF COMMAND: ACTIVE
As per the alarm above, but with the command activated via the "REMOTE" connector. ( EPO )
[21] MEMORY CHANGED: CODE = number
Code 1 the memory has been changed and the system functional parameters have returned to their default
setting.
NOTE: codes other than 1 may appear temporarily without affecting the normal operation of the system.
[22] AUTO-OFF Timer: Toff= 0: 0', Ton= 0: 0'
This alarm is activated as the machine starts counting down, when it is about to be switched on or off as part of
the on-off cycle set using the daily timer.
The timer is normally deactivated.
